Exim não enviando e-mail remotamente

1

Estou usando o exim4. Eu configurei e executei. Mas isso só funciona para o host local. Quando eu tento fazer algo parecido com este exim4 -v [email protected], isso me dá o erro de tempo limite de conexão.

O que há de errado em enviar e-mails para localização remota?

este é o erro que recebo

mx4.hotmail.com [65.54.188.110] Tempo limite da conexão

    
por usmanali 21.01.2011 / 11:07

3 respostas

2

Aqui está o meu palpite .. Você está fazendo isso a partir de uma conexão de internet em casa. A maioria dos ISPs bloqueia conexões de saída para a porta 25 com todos os outros hosts, mas com seus próprios servidores de email para impedir que as pessoas enviem spam de suas conexões domésticas ou para parar os bots de spam.

    
por 21.01.2011 / 11:25
1

A configuração padrão do EXIM não permite a retransmissão.

  # Insist that any other recipient address that we accept is either in one of
  # our local domains, or is in a domain for which we explicitly allow
  # relaying. Any other domain is rejected as being unacceptable for relaying.

  require message = relay not permitted
          domains = +local_domains : +relay_to_domains

Se você remover o argumento acima (linha 455 no meu /etc/exim/exim.conf), então a retransmissão aberta será permitida através do EXIM, o que é ruim. No entanto, você pode dar um tiro para fins de teste. Entenda primeiro que NINGUÉM será capaz de retransmitir e-mails através de seu MTA nesse ponto - eventualmente, o SPAM será disseminado de seu servidor, seu domínio terminará em listas negras, etc., se você não restaurá-lo em breve.

Para que o EXIM funcione como um servidor de retransmissão moderno, você deve ler o tópico sobre autenticação. A configuração padrão do EXIM permitirá a retransmissão para clientes de email autenticados. Este é o livro oficial: link

Você tem ou pretende usar o LDAP para armazenar nomes de usuário e senhas - no que se refere à autenticação de seus usuários de email?

Aqui está também um bom artigo. Ele deve fornecer uma ideia holística do que é necessário para configurar um servidor de e-mail baseado em EXIM MTA - com o LDAP devo adicionar. O howto é específico do Debian: link

    
por 10.02.2011 / 19:29
0

Se o seu ISP estiver bloqueando o tráfego de saída na porta 25, é possível que eles tenham um servidor de retransmissão que você tem permissão para usar. Fale com eles para descobrir e, se o fizerem, configure o exim para enviar todos os emails de saída através de um smarthost, onde o endereço IP do smarthost é o servidor de retransmissão do ISP.

    
por 05.03.2011 / 23:44

Tags